Installation Process

The installation process for a cat window flap generally involves the following steps:
Measuring the Window or Door: The installer determines the window or door to determine the best area for the cat window flap.Cutting a Hole: A hole is cut into the window or door to accommodate the cat window flap.Installing the Flap: The cat window flap is set up into the hole, usually utilizing screws or adhesive.Sealing the Edges: The edges of the flap are sealed to prevent air leaks and moisture from entering your house.Testing the Flap: The installer evaluates the flap to make sure that it is working properly which the cat can pass through quickly.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What is the best material for a cat window flap?A: The best material for a cat window flap depends upon the environment and the preferred level of durability. Common materials consist of plastic, metal, and wood.

Q: Can I set up a cat window flap myself?A: Yes, it is possible to set up a cat window flap yourself using a DIY set. However, if you are not comfy with DIY jobs or if you have a complex installation, it is advised to work with a professional installer.

Q: How long does it require to set up a cat window flap?A: The installation time for a cat window flap normally varies from 30 minutes to numerous hours, depending upon the complexity of the installation and the kind of flap being installed.

Q: Can I install a cat window flap in a rental property?A: It is advised to consult your proprietor or residential or commercial property manager before installing a cat window flap in a rental home. Some rental arrangements may forbid the installation of cat window flaps or need authorization from the property owner.
